Actualy this hose came as a package with the swirl tank setup. I am not sure what hoses I am going to be using for the setup, but really swaying to the teflon ones as they don't have the interior smelling of fuel, may mean more fittings as the do not like bending too much. Still also contemplating getting a hardline setup and a pipe bender off Ebay and doing the lines myself, might not be that expensive. We'll see how it goes, need to get some stuff done this weekend. don't forget the flare tool or you can use the Earls tubing adapters. I'm doing all in engine fuel / vaccum hoses with prolite 350. Reading mixed reviews on the fuel filter, bronze vs paper filters. I'm not converting it all to AN though, one end is going to use regular nipples and econo-fit clamps.
